Default IPC claims three prizes and UBM four at PPA awards

Editorial campaign of the year was awarded to UBM Building magazine for its Safer skyline campaign./ppPresenting the consumer brand prize, the PPA judges praised Nuts's ability "respond at every turn to the needs and desires of its audience" and its qualities of "sharing the passion of the reader and demonstrating a single-minded commercial exploitation of the brand"./ppIPC's third award in the ceremony at the Grosvenor House hotel, London, went to NME.com, which won interactive consumer magazine of the year./ppThe independently published free weekly magazine Shortlist also fared well, with its publisher, the former IPC Media executive Mike Soutar, collecting two prizes./ppSoutar's Shortlist Media was named consumer magazine publisher of the year and publisher of the year with an annual turnover under £5m./pp/ppConsumer magazine editor of the year went to Alexander Milas from Future Publishing's music magazine Metal Hammer./pp/ppReed Business Information collected two awards, as XpertHR was named business media brand of the year and business website of the year went to FWI.co.uk./pp/ppThe PPA judges praised XpertHR's approach to moving the brand to meet the dynamics of its market, saying it had a "compelling and impressive example of brand diversification"./pp/ppMonty Don was named consumer media columnist of the year for his contribution to BBC Magazines publication Gardeners' World. BBC Magazines collected a second award as Top Gear was named international consumer magazine of the year./pp/ppConsumer magazine writer of the year went to Robert Chalmers of Condé Nast's GQ, while business columnist of the year went to Mark Ritson from Haymarket Business Media's Marketing title./pp/ppNational Magazine Company's Coast magazine collected the specialist consumer magazine of the year award, while business publisher of the year was awarded to Louise Rogers of Times Higher Education./pp/ppThe winners were chosen from 186 finalists, from 102 titles and 37 publishing companies. a href="http://content.yudu.com/A19vcw/PPA09/resources/index.htm?referrerUrl=" title="can be found here"/a/ppem• To contact the MediaGuardian news desk email editor@mediaguardian.co.uk or phone 020 3353 3857.
